Second PiGs event ‘hits the spot’

“I loves it I does! That was gert lush!”

The second People in Glazing Society AKA PiGs networking event in Bristol was another record-breaking event, with over a hundred industry supporters from across the glazing supply chain in attendance.

Taking place at a new location at Brown & Bye on 13 June, this was the third year that PiGs has hosted an event in Bristol, with each year garnering more attention from the sector.

There was also a European feel to this year’s event, with PiGs supporter Soudal bringing a contingent from its headquarters in Turnhout, Belgium.

Alongside the usual networking opportunities and chance to meet up with industry colleagues both old and new, the event also played host to the ‘Pay to Play’ Euro 24 sweepstake, with £240 raised going towards the PiGs Charity of the Year for 2024, Kelly’s Heroes.

‘Chief PiG’  Sarah Ball said of the night: “I love coming back to Bristol because I spent 13 years here. It always feels special, and having a record turnout was the icing on the cake. We couldn’t do any of this without our super event sponsors, as this puts money behind the bar to get the party started.

“The new location worked a treat despite the wind and rain thrown at us! I would like to say a huge thank you to everyone who turned up for the evening, and it was good to see some new faces. This goes to prove that the glazing sector is the best industry in the world.”

PiGs now heads to the North-East and Newcastle for the third networking event, the ‘PiGs ‘Summer Party’, on Thursday 22 August 2024.
